President Yoweri Kaguta Museveni has received credentials from three new Ambassadors-designate to Uganda, signaling renewed commitment to strengthening bilateral relations in trade, investment, and socio-economic cooperation. The envoys include Ms. Margaret Gaynor of Ireland, Mrs. Virginie Leroy of France, and Ms. Morakot Janemathukorn of Thailand. The Committee on National Economy has called on government to review its proposed €183.3 million loan from Standard Chartered Bank, UK, and Shs120.4 billion from the domestic market through a six-month Treasury Bill for the Strategic Towns Water Supply and Sanitation Project – Phase II. The Deputy Speaker, Thomas Tayebwa Members of Parliament have called on government to negotiate better bi-lateral agreements on labour externalisation, following a recent British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C) documentary that showcased Ugandan girls involved in sex slavery in the United Arab Emirates.
